Marieberg Cemetery is located in Göteborg, Sweden. It serves as a burial ground and is part of the city's historical landscape. The cemetery is known for its serene environment, featuring landscaped areas that provide a tranquil setting for visitors and families of the deceased.
Established in the 19th century, Marieberg Cemetery reflects various architectural styles and burial traditions. It is the final resting place for many notable individuals, contributing to its significance in the local community. The cemetery is also a site of historical interest, with monuments and gravestones that showcase the cultural heritage of the region.
In addition to its primary function as a burial site, Marieberg Cemetery is often visited for its peaceful atmosphere and natural beauty. The grounds are designed to accommodate visitors who wish to pay their respects or explore the historical aspects of the cemetery.
